Ricciardo feared retirement for power issue

Getty Images Enlarge Daniel Ricciardo says he spent half the Singapore Grand Prix worrying a power issue would spell the end of his Singapore Grand Prix as he finished third at Marina Bay. In the closing stages Ricciardo was closing on struggling team-mate Sebastian Vettel while coming under pressure from Ferrari's Fernando Alonso for the final podium spot. But Ricciardo admits the looming Ferrari had been the least of his worries for the second half of the race. "We had quite a bit going on - power was coming and going and, pretty much from the safety car onwards, it was consistently down on power," Ricciardo said.
